Where Are the Luxury Neighborhoods in Greenville, SC?

For many buyers, the first step is identifying where to focus their search. Greenville offers

several well-known areas associated with luxury homes and established property values.

North Main

Located just north of downtown, North Main is known for its walkability and character. The

area features a mix of historic homes and newer custom construction, often on larger lots.

Augusta Road/Alta Vista

These neighborhoods are among the most established in Greenville, SC real estate. Tree-lined

streets, classic architecture, and consistent resale demand contribute to their long-term appeal.

Chanticleer

Chanticleer is one of Greenville’s most recognized prestige neighborhoods, offering traditional

homes, mature landscaping, and a strong sense of continuity.

Hollingsworth Park

Hollingsworth Park is a newer development with thoughtfully designed streetscapes,

community green spaces, and modern custom homes.Paris Mountain

Tucked just minutes from downtown, Paris Mountain offers a more private, wooded setting

with larger lots, custom homes, and a quiet, tucked-away feel while still staying close to

Greenville.

The Cliffs Communities

Located throughout Upstate South Carolina, The Cliffs communities provide gated living, golf

amenities, and mountain or lake views. These communities are often chosen for their lifestyle

offerings as much as their homes.

Lake Keowee Area

The Lake Keowee area features waterfront high-end homes, private docks, and expansive

views. It represents some of the highest price points in the broader Greenville market.

Each of these areas offers a different combination of location, design, and lifestyle, which is

why clarity around priorities is so important when starting a search.

How Is Buying a Luxury Home Different?

Buying a luxury home involves additional layers of consideration compared to a typical

transaction. Pricing, financing, inspections, and negotiations often require a more tailored

approach.

Financing

Luxury purchases often involve jumbo loans, which have different qualification requirements

than standard financing. These loans may require larger down payments, more extensive

financial documentation, and longer approval timelines. Some buyers also explore cash

purchases or portfolio lending options.Pricing

At higher price points, comparable sales data is more limited. Evaluating a property’s value

often requires a deeper understanding of the Greenville real estate market, including

neighborhood trends and recent activity that may not be widely visible.

Inspections

Luxury homes frequently include additional features such as pools, custom systems, acreage, or

secondary structures. These elements may require specialized inspections beyond a standard

home inspection.

Negotiation

Negotiations in luxury transactions often extend beyond purchase price. Timelines,

contingencies, included furnishings, and other terms can all shape the structure of the

agreement.

Privacy and Access

Some luxury homes in Greenville, SC are marketed privately or shared within agent networks

before appearing publicly. Access to these opportunities often depends on local connections

and market awareness.

What Does the Luxury Market in Greenville Look Like Right

Now?

The Greenville, SC luxury market continues to see steady interest from both local and relocating

buyers. Many are drawn by Greenville’s quality of life, access to outdoor amenities, and relative

value compared to larger metro areas.The luxury segment tends to operate on its own timeline. Homes may remain on the market

longer than mid-range properties, while well-positioned listings in desirable areas continue to

attract strong interest.

Inventory at the top end can shift throughout the year. In some cases, the most sought-after

properties are identified and transacted through relationships before reaching broader

exposure.

What Counts as a Luxury Home in Greenville?

In the Greenville market, luxury homes typically begin around $750,000 to $1 million and

extend well into the multi-million-dollar range.

Beyond price, buyers often evaluate:

• Location

• Lot size

• Architectural quality

• Custom finishes

• Access to amenities such as golf, lake frontage, or gated communities

Luxury in Greenville reflects a combination of these elements, along with how a property

supports day-to-day living and long-term goals.

What qualifies as luxury in Greenville may differ from markets like Charlotte, Atlanta, or coastal

South Carolina, and that relative value is part of what continues to attract buyers to the area.

Do You Need a Luxury Real Estate Agent in Greenville?

Luxury transactions involve higher financial stakes and more detailed coordination.

South Carolina requires a real estate attorney to handle the legal aspects of closing, including

document preparation and fund transfer. Alongside that, a real estate agent plays a key role in

guiding the transaction—from pricing strategy and negotiation to managing timelines and

communication.An agent with experience in luxury real estate in Greenville, SC can provide insight into market

dynamics, access to off-market opportunities, and an understanding of expectations at this

level.
